The Billionaire is a vacation hookup turned long-distance no-strings romance between a college senior studying marketing and a lawyer roughly a decade her senior. It is told in dual, alternating first-person POV and is the second in the Dalton Brothers series of interconnected standalones, which can be read out of order.

The Billionaire is book two in the Dalton Brothers series and is the forbidden, age gap, second chance romance of Jenner and Joanna.
Jenner is a high-profile lawyer, a billionaire, and a deliciously hot eligible bachelor in Los Angeles. He heads to Vegas for March Madness with his brothers and friends.
Joanna (Jo) is a sweet college girl living in Miami. She heads to Vegas during Spring Break with her girlfriends.
The chemistry and attraction between Jenner and Jo is instant and concupiscent when they meet in a sport bar in Vegas. Jo impresses Jenner with her knowledge of sports and betting, so his attraction extends to her mind as well as her body. That insta connection turns from one night to a whole weekend and then they find themselves jetting back and forth between LA and Miami to spend time together, all the while neither are willing to admit to wanting more.
